The correct answer is that the code interpreter tool does not support visualization libraries. This is because Azure AI Foundry’s code interpreter operates in a sandboxed Python environment intentionally stripped of resource-intensive packages like Matplotlib, Seaborn, or Plotly to maintain security and performance, so any attempt to generate plots will fail with import or runtime errors. On the AI-102 exam, this tests your understanding of the tool’s sandbox limitations versus its intended use for data manipulation and file generation—a common trap is assuming the interpreter mirrors a full local Python environment. To remember this, think “code interpreter is for code, not charts”; if a question mentions plotting, visualize the missing libraries as the root cause.

Detailed technical explanation
How to think about this question
The code_interpreter tool runs Python in a restricted environment with a predefined set of allowed libraries, typically limited to data manipulation and basic I/O (e.g., pandas, numpy, json). Visualization libraries like Matplotlib require GUI backends or file output capabilities that are not available in this sandbox. In real-world scenarios, developers must use alternative approaches such as generating plot data as CSV or JSON and rendering it externally, or using Azure's built-in charting capabilities.
